PANews reported on February 5 that according to SoSoValue data, yesterday (February 4, Eastern Time), the total net inflow of Bitcoin spot ETFs was US$341 million. Yesterday, Grayscale ETF GBTC had a net inflow of US$19.5412 million, and the current historical net outflow of GBTC is US$21.864 billion. Grayscale Bitcoin Mini Trust ETF BTC had a net outflow of US$0.00 per day, and the current historical total net inflow of Grayscale Bitcoin Mini Trust BTC is US$1.232 billion. The Bitcoin spot ETF with the largest net inflow in a single day yesterday was BlackRock ETF IBIT, with a net inflow of US$249 million per day, and the current historical total net inflow of IBIT is US$40.729 billion. The second is Ark Invest and 21Shares ETF ARKB, with a net inflow of US$56.1234 million per day, and the current historical total net inflow of ARKB is US$2.952 billion. As of press time, the total net asset value of the Bitcoin spot ETF was US$116.044 billion, the ETF net asset ratio (market value as a percentage of the total market value of Bitcoin) was 5.93%, and the historical cumulative net inflow has reached US$40.603 billion.
